Output 8266fc0314cac1a306ced00b4a6b443c2e84c741dce22d0e57e04c02aae382b6:16

value
70000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5965f5f17ace16ece56100c9c49c72a18d77cab823717dc989479e0b6f17ed2d
address
tb1pt9jltut6ectweetpqryuf8rj5xxh0j4cydchmjvfg70qkmcha5ksq7qcch
transaction
8266fc0314cac1a306ced00b4a6b443c2e84c741dce22d0e57e04c02aae382b6
confirmations
51691
spent
true